Batch records as typed programs

2025 – present · AstraZeneca

Approval is a node, not a convention — typed ports, only same-typed ones connect, and human approval sits inside the grammar.

Batch records are authored as documents and executed as programs, and the gap between the two is where validation effort goes. This is a visual builder for master and executed batch records in Rust and React, including a browser-only build with no backend at all, so the authoring surface works where a server cannot be deployed.

The grammar is a visual pipeline with a type system: boxes are nodes, arrows are typed edges — rows, table, scalar, signal — and only same-typed ports may be wired. Every recipe instantiates one spine: source, pre-process, reason (AI), approve (human), sink. Human approval is a first-class node in the grammar rather than a workflow convention bolted on afterwards — the same conclusion as the pooling gate above, reached independently in a different domain. Records are governed in git: review, environment promotion, rollback.

Underneath it, twenty years back to pharmaceutical manufacturing execution systems in validated GxP environments.
